Introduction:
Thousands of plants which occur in different ecosystem they all share the same requirements in order to survive, grow. These referred to as abiotic factors. Abiotic factors are essentially non-living components that affect the living organisms .There are six abiotic factors that affect plant growth: air, water, space, temperature, light and soil (nutrients). These are the basic favorable environmental conditions, its allow them to successfully live and reproduce.Light
Light energy is the primary source of energy in nearly all ecosystems. Photosynthesis is the process by which plants turn sunlight into food. Visible light is of the greatest importance to plants because it is necessary for photosynthesis this process is directly dependent on the supply of water, light, and carbon dioxide.From the air with the sun’s energy to create photosynthesis. Oxygen is releases as a byproduct.
Photosynthesis ooccurs only in the chloroplasts, tiny sub-cellular structures contained in the cells of leaves and green stems.is responsible for making the leaves and stem green. Limiting any one of the factors can limit photosynthesis regardless of the availability of the other factor it will reduction in photosynthesis and thus a decrease in plant vigor and growth or without the process of photosynthesis, plant stops growing.
There are Factors such as quality of light; intensity of light and the length of the light period (day length) play an important part in an ecosystem. Increased hours of lighting allow the plant to make sufficient food to grow. However, plants require some period of darkness to develop properly and thus should be haves certain hours. Excessive light is as harmful as too little or no light. When a plant gets too much direct light, the leaves become pale, sometimes, turn brown, and die.

DISCUSSION:
The photosynthetic process occurs most readily when the light to makes food for itself to grow. In leaves, Chlorophyll that contains chloroplasts to absorb light. Without light, plant growing in the dark uses their food reserves. Once the reserves have been used the plant will die. Also the stem of the plant rapidly elongates to increase the probability of the plant finding light by using its food reserves, so when plant does not find light has used these reserves, it will die.
Leaf ColorThe color plant's leaves are closely related to how much light it gets. Generally, plants that require a great deal of sunlight tend to have leaves that are rich and dark in color, while the leaves of plants grown in dark and too much light conditions are often lighter yellowish green.
Stem Length and BranchThe amount of light a plant receives has a large impact on the length of its stems. Plants that receive a great deal of light tend to be spindly and long in length, while those grown in low-light or no light conditions are usually shorter. However, dark they become less branch because there no light to get there energy that process photosynthesis and develop new tissue to build up organs.
